LA CROSSE, Wis. (Blugolds.com) – It was a close battle nearly the entire way but a late run helped the UW-Eau Claire women's basketball team defeat UW-La Crosse 57-47 in Mitchell Hall Saturday afternoon.

Eau Claire led the majority of the game but only led by as many as six points once during the first 34 minutes. In that same stretch, La Crosse led by as many as three points while it was tied six times.

After a 35-35 tie with less than 10 minutes to play, the Blugolds worked their way to a six point lead. The Eagles then went on a 5-0 run to get back to within one (43-42) with less than four minutes left, but over the next two minutes, the Blugolds used a 9-0 to get up by 10. The closest La Crosse got the rest of the way was seven points.

Teenie Lichtfuss (So.-Oshkosh, Wis./Lourdes) led the Blugolds in scoring with 15 points while Courtney Lewis (Jr.-Prairie du Chien, Wis.) finished the game with 12. Lewis also had seven rebounds to tie a team-high with Rachel Egdorf (Jr.-Mishicot, Wis.).

Both teams made 18 baskets from the field but Eau Claire had six three-pointers to just three for the Eagles. The Blugolds also had 15 points from the free throw line while La Crosse scored 12.

Eau Claire is now 5-15 overall and 3-8 in the WIAC while La Crosse drops to 9-11 on the season and 3-8 in conference play. Earlier this season on Dec. 7, the Blugolds fell to UW-La Crosse in Zorn Arena, 63-54.
